Decoding Process: amM= to jc

Step 1: Map Base64 Characters to Binary

Base64 CharacterBinary ValueDecimal Value
a01101026
m10011038
M00110012
=padding (000000)-

Step 2: Group Bits into Bytes

The binary string is grouped into 8-bit chunks (1 byte each):

01101010 01100011 00

Step 3: Convert Binary to ASCII

Binary ValueASCII Character
01101010j
01100011c
00

When combined, these characters form the decoded string: "jc"
